Surface Preparation for Optimal Adhesion

Before any paint even touches the building, the surface needs to be prepped. This is probably the most important step, honestly. If you don’t prep right, the paint won’t stick well, and you’ll be looking at problems down the line.

Here’s what we typically do:

  1. Cleaning: We thoroughly wash down the surfaces to remove dirt, grime, mold, and any chalking residue. This might involve pressure washing or specialized cleaning solutions.
  2. Scraping and Sanding: Loose paint is scraped away, and surfaces are sanded to create a smooth profile for new paint to adhere to.
  3. Priming: We apply a high-quality primer. This seals the surface, provides a uniform base, and helps the topcoat stick better. It’s like giving the paint a good foundation to build on.

Proper surface preparation is the backbone of a long-lasting paint job. Skipping this step is like building a house on sand – it just won’t hold up.

Weather Resistance in Burlington’s Climate

Burlington’s weather can be pretty unpredictable, right? We get those hot, sunny summers that can really bake a building’s exterior, and then the harsh winters with snow, ice, and freezing rain. This constant cycle puts a lot of stress on paint. Choosing the right paint isn’t just about looks; it’s about defense. High-quality exterior paints are formulated to stand up to these conditions. They create a barrier that helps prevent moisture from seeping in, which can cause all sorts of problems like peeling, blistering, and even structural damage over time. Think of it like a good raincoat for your building – it keeps the elements out.

Here’s what to look for in paint that can handle our local weather:

  • UV Resistance: Protects against fading and chalking from intense sun.
  • Flexibility: Allows the paint to expand and contract with temperature changes without cracking.
  • Moisture Barrier: Repels water while still allowing the surface to breathe.
  • Mildew and Algae Resistance: Keeps the exterior looking clean and fresh, especially in humid conditions.

Sustainable and Eco-Friendly Paint Options

When it comes to painting your industrial buildings, you have more choices than ever before for environmentally conscious options. Many manufacturers now offer paints with low or zero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s). These paints are better for the air quality around your property and for the health of the workers applying them. Some paints also come with special reflective properties that can help reduce your building’s energy consumption. This means less reliance on heating and cooling systems, which is good for your bottom line and the planet.

Here are some benefits of choosing eco-friendly paints:

  • Improved Air Quality: Reduced VOCs mean less harmful stuff released into the atmosphere.
  • Energy Savings: Reflective coatings can lower cooling costs in warmer months.
  • Durability: Many eco-friendly options are formulated for long-lasting performance, reducing the need for frequent repainting.
  • Healthier Work Environment: Less off-gassing benefits everyone on-site.

How long does exterior paint usually last on industrial buildings?

The paint can last for many years, often 5 to 10 years or even longer, if it’s good quality and put on correctly. Things like the type of paint, how much sun and rain it gets, and how well the surface was prepped before painting can all affect how long it lasts.

What’s the best way to prepare a building’s surface before painting?

Before painting, you need to clean the surface really well. This means washing off dirt, grime, and any old, peeling paint. Sometimes, you might need to fix small cracks or holes. Getting the surface clean and smooth helps the new paint stick better and last longer.
